Shared Tank Conditions
Downoi fits inside the water range normally used for Whisker Shrimp. The shared window is about 20 to 28 °C, pH 7 to 7.5, and 5 to 12 dGH, which gives you enough room to aim for stable middle-ground conditions.
Both do best with moderate flow, so circulation does not need to be split into competing zones.
Both are suited to freshwater, so salinity does not add an extra planning problem.
Fish Pressure and Plant Resilience
Whisker Shrimp can still be rough on plants, but this pairing becomes more realistic when the plant is anchored well and used as part of a larger layout.
Downoi has moderate cover density, low uproot resistance, and delicate leaves. It can also help with shrimp refuge and grazing surfaces.
Its structure adds useful refuge value beyond the normal visual role of the plant.
The point to watch is whisker Shrimp usually looks better with denser planting than this species provides on its own.
Layout Fit
Downoi is a stem plant usually used foreground and midground.
Whisker Shrimp is an invertebrate, so the pairing works best when the planting style supports how that fish uses space and cover.
Downoi reaches about 10 cm tall by 10 cm wide and is usually rooted in substrate with nutrient-rich substrate preferred. That makes placement and anchoring more important than simply adding a larger bunch of stems or leaves.
In this pairing, the useful plant values are shrimp refuge and grazing surfaces. Place it where Whisker Shrimp can actually use that structure instead of hiding the plant where it cannot do much.
